WebDec 2, 2016 · Call LHDN at 1-800-88-5436 (LHDN) and then ask where is your tax file located. Because you need to go to the specified branch to clear your tax. Go to the branch that they specified, and don’t forget to bring all of the documents I mentioned earlier. Go to the counter and just tell them you want to do your tax clearance, and you all set.
